I am facing difficulty to establish 3G WAN connection in Cisco 881G router.
In debug it shows:

===========

*Aug  9 10:39:45.127: CHAT3: Attempting async line dialer script

*Aug  9 10:39:45.127: CHAT3: Dialing using Modem script: BLINK & System
script: none

*Aug  9 10:39:45.131: CHAT3: process started

*Aug  9 10:39:45.131: CHAT3: Asserting DTR

*Aug  9 10:39:45.131: CHAT3: Chat script BLINK started

*Aug  9 10:39:45.131: CHAT3: Sending string: ATDT*99*1#

*Aug  9 10:39:45.131: CHAT3: Expecting string: CONNECT

*Aug  9 10:40:15.131: CHAT3: Timeout expecting: CONNECT

*Aug  9 10:40:15.131: CHAT3: Chat script BLINK finished, status =
Connection timed out; remote host not responding

================
LAB-CCC#   sh cell 0 radio
Radio power mode = ON
Current Band = WCDMA 2100, Channel Number = 10738
Current RSSI = -74 dBm
Band Selected = Auto
Number of nearby cells = 1
Cell 1
        Primary Scrambling Code = 0xC7
        RSCP = -82 dBm, ECIO = -5 dBm
=======================

Int Cell 0 is not getting IP.
